%X Theranostic matched pairs of radionuclides have aroused interest during the last couple ofyears, and in that sense, copper is one element that has a lot to offer, and although 61Cu and 64Cu areslowly being established as diagnostic radionuclides for PET, the availability of the therapeutic counterpart 67Cu plays a key role for further radiopharmaceutical development in the future. Until now,the 67Cu shortage has not been solved; however, different production routes are being explored. Thisproject aims at the production of no-carrier-added 67Cu with high radionuclidic purity with a medical30 MeV compact cyclotron via the 70Zn(p,α)67Cu reaction. With this purpose, proton irradiation ofelectrodeposited 70Zn targets was performed followed by two-step radiochemical separation based onsolid-phase extraction.
